<p></p>
<p>Doing a copy of a large amount of text always crashes geany.</p>
<p>This is an example of a file that crashes:<br>
wget "<a href="https://neo.sci.gsfc.nasa.gov/servlet/RenderData?si=1784251&cs=rgb&format=CSV&width=360&height=180" rel="nofollow">https://neo.sci.gsfc.nasa.gov/servlet/RenderData?si=1784251&cs=rgb&format=CSV&width=360&height=180</a>"</p>
<p>To reproduce: Open file, ctrl-a, ctrl-c<br>
and geany crashes and disappears.</p>
<p>$ uname -a<br>
Linux mu00038561 4.4.0-197-generic <a class="issue-link js-issue-link" data-error-text="Failed to load title" data-id="29993160" data-permission-text="Title is private" data-url="https://github.com/geany/geany/issues/229" data-hovercard-type="pull_request" data-hovercard-url="/geany/geany/pull/229/hovercard" href="https://github.com/geany/geany/pull/229">#229</a>-Ubuntu SMP Wed Nov 25 11:05:42 UTC 2020 x86_64 x86_64 x86_64 GNU/Linux<br>
$ dpkg -l geany<br>
Desired=Unknown/Install/Remove/Purge/Hold<br>
|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end<br>
|/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ad)<br>
||/ Name           Version      Architecture Description<br>
+++-==============-============-============-=================================<br>
ii  geany          1.27-1       amd64        fast and lightweight IDE</p>
<p>$ gdb -ex run --args geany -v "RenderData?si=1784251&cs=rgb&format=CSV&width=360&height=180"<br>
GNU gdb (Ubuntu 7.11.1-0ubuntu1~16.5) 7.11.1<br>
Copyright (C) 2016 Free Software Foundation, Inc.<br>
License GPLv3+: GNU GPL version 3 or later <a href="http://gnu.org/licenses/gpl.html" rel="nofollow">http://gnu.org/licenses/gpl.html</a><br>
This is free software: you are free to change and redistribute it.<br>
There is NO WARRANTY, to the extent permitted by law.  Type "show copying"<br>
and "show warranty" for details.<br>
This GDB was configured as "x86_64-linux-gnu".<br>
Type "show configuration" for configuration details.<br>
For bug reporting instructions, please see:<br>
<a href="http://www.gnu.org/software/gdb/bugs/" rel="nofollow">http://www.gnu.org/software/gdb/bugs/</a>.<br>
Find the GDB manual and other documentation resources online at:<br>
<a href="http://www.gnu.org/software/gdb/documentation/" rel="nofollow">http://www.gnu.org/software/gdb/documentation/</a>.<br>
For help, type "help".<br>
Type "apropos word" to search for commands related to "word"...<br>
Reading symbols from geany...(no debugging symbols found)...done.<br>
Starting program: /usr/bin/geany -v RenderData?si=1784251&cs=rgb&format=CSV&width=360&height=180<br>
[Thread debugging using libthread_db enabled]<br>
Using host libthread_db library "/lib/x86_64-linux-gnu/libthread_db.so.1".<br>
Geany-INFO: Geany 1.27, en_AU.UTF-8<br>
Geany-INFO: GTK 2.24.30, GLib 2.48.2<br>
Geany-INFO: System data dir: /usr/share/geany<br>
Geany-INFO: User config dir: /home/kerryn/.config/geany<br>
[New Thread 0x7fffee0c6700 (LWP 12732)]<br>
[New Thread 0x7fffed8c5700 (LWP 12733)]<br>
[New Thread 0x7fffed0c4700 (LWP 12734)]<br>
Geany-INFO: System plugin path: /usr/lib/x86_64-linux-gnu/geany<br>
Geany-INFO: Added filetype Cython (61).<br>
Geany-INFO: Added filetype Scala (62).<br>
Geany-INFO: Added filetype Genie (63).<br>
Geany-INFO: Added filetype Graphviz (64).<br>
Geany-INFO: Added filetype JSON (65).<br>
Geany-INFO: Added filetype CUDA (66).<br>
Geany-INFO: Added filetype Clojure (67).<br>
Geany-INFO: /home/kerryn/git/2019-04-CRC-IRP4/SalisburyFInal/Analysis/test/PrecinctUTCIData3.csv : None (UTF-8)<br>
Geany-INFO: /media/kerryn/87d9469d-56aa-4a1f-a62d-5f03d7599bbf/Data/NDVI2/2020/RenderData?si=1784251&cs=rgb&format=CSV&width=360&height=180 : None (UTF-8)<br>
The program 'geany' received an X Window System error.<br>
This probably reflects a bug in the program.<br>
The error was 'BadWindow (invalid Window parameter)'.<br>
(Details: serial 6801 error_code 3 request_code 18 minor_code 0)<br>
(Note to programmers: normally, X errors are reported asynchronously;<br>
that is, you will receive the error a while after causing it.<br>
To debug your program, run it with the --sync command line<br>
option to change this behavior. You can then get a meaningful<br>
backtrace from your debugger if you break on the gdk_x_error() function.)<br>
[Thread 0x7fffed8c5700 (LWP 12733) exited]<br>
[Thread 0x7fffee0c6700 (LWP 12732) exited]<br>
[Thread 0x7ffff7f6c980 (LWP 12728) exited]<br>
[Inferior 1 (process 12728) exited with code 01]<br>
(gdb)</p>

<p style="font-size:small;-webkit-text-size-adjust:none;color:#666;">—<br />You are receiving this because you are subscribed to this thread.<br />Reply to this email directly, <a href="https://github.com/geany/geany/issues/2752">view it on GitHub</a>, or <a href="https://github.com/notifications/unsubscribe-auth/AAIOWJYMYJ7YHKKDLRCR7TTS7XHEJANCNFSM4X3SHDUQ">unsubscribe</a>.<img src="https://github.com/notifications/beacon/AAIOWJZ3OFRRVR4BWHV23S3S7XHEJA5CNFSM4X3SHDU2YY3PNVWWK3TUL52HS4DFUVEXG43VMWVGG33NNVSW45C7NFSM4MDATGIQ.gif" height="1" width="1" alt="" /></p>
<script type="application/ld+json">[
{
"@context": "http://schema.org",
"@type": "EmailMessage",
"potentialAction": {
"@type": "ViewAction",
"target": "https://github.com/geany/geany/issues/2752",
"url": "https://github.com/geany/geany/issues/2752",
"name": "View Issue"
},
"description": "View this Issue on GitHub",
"publisher": {
"@type": "Organization",
"name": "GitHub",
"url": "https://github.com"
}
}
]</script>